Taraxa (TARA) is a distinct, rapid, and scalable Layer-1 public ledger crafted to democratize reputation by rendering informal data reliable. This blockchain platform is designed to audit informal transactions, equipping businesses with the necessary tools to make informed decisions. By concentrating on informal data, Taraxa aims to introduce transparency and reliability into daily interactions commonly neglected by conventional systems. Central to Taraxa's technology is its EVM-compatible smart contract platform, utilizing the t-Graph consensus mechanism and blockDAG architecture. This blend ensures high throughput and low latency, making it ideal for a variety of decentralized applications. The t-Graph consensus is especially noteworthy for its proficiency in handling complex transaction workflows effectively. TARA, the native token, holds a vital role within the Taraxa ecosystem. It is employed for several functions, including voting on governance proposals, paying gas fees for transactions, and staking to secure the network. This multi-functional utility underscores TARA's essential contribution to the platform's operations and governance.
